OneKey Router
Provides a proxy for accessing commercial and non-commercial MCP servers, enabling unified authentication, discounted rates, and revenue sharing for AI agents and API providers.
About
The OneKey Router serves as a centralized proxy server designed to simplify access to various commercial and non-commercial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ers and AI agent APIs. It allows users to authenticate to multiple services with a single access key, significantly reducing costs through discounted rates and a credit-based system. Beyond streamlining user access, the platform also implements a unique revenue-sharing initiative, enabling MCP API and AI agent service providers to monetize their offerings, even for low-frequency usage, by consolidating requests and facilitating a two-party credit exchange.
Key Features
- Access commercial and non-commercial MCP servers with a single authentication key
- Gain free tier access and discounted rates on various MCP services (e.g., Google Maps, Web Search)
- Supports revenue sharing and monetization for MCP APIs and AI Agent services via a credit system
- Acts as a proxy router supporting streaming HTTP services for MCPs
- Simplifies configuration for desktop clients (e.g., Claude, Cursor) and web-based AI agent terminals

Use Cases
- Users seeking to consolidate API access and reduce costs for multiple commercial MCP services
- MCP or AI agent service providers looking to monetize their APIs and reach a wider user base
- Developers integrating various MCP services into AI agents or applications without managing multiple individual API keys
